1998 Chevrolet Lumina electrical system problems
17 owner complaints filed with NHTSA name the electrical system on the 1998 Chevrolet Lumina — 8% of all complaints for this model year.

Electrical System problems in other Lumina years
| Year | Reports | Share |
|---|---|---|
| 2001 Lumina | 2 | 10% |
| 2000 Lumina | 3 | 10% |
| 1999 Lumina | 8 | 8% |
| 1997 Lumina | 26 | 7% |
| 1996 Lumina | 30 | 12% |
| 1995 Lumina | 43 | 9% |
| 1994 Lumina | 17 | 13% |
| 1993 Lumina | 29 | 12% |
| 1992 Lumina | 44 | 13% |
| 1991 Lumina | 24 | 7% |
| 1990 Lumina | 24 | 6% |
